Internal Injury Lawyers

There are many kinds of internal injuries that one might suffer from. This includes brain bleeding and broken ribs.

Spleen Damage

The spleen in your immune system filters blood cells and assists in fighting infections. It is located on the left side of your body. It is located under your rib cage.

If you notice that your spleen has ruptured, it is crucial to seek medical attention immediately. Failure to act quickly can lead to serious complications, that could prove fatal.

A spleen that has ruptured could cause bleeding in your abdomen. A splenic leak could cause abdominal pain, nausea dizziness, nausea, and low blood pressure. Surgery may be required if the spleen has ruptured.

Some people may have a hematoma. It can be caused by ruptured spleen or a punctured lungs. They can cause breathing difficulties as well as chest tightness and coughing.

Punctured Lung or Pneumothorax

You could be eligible to make a claim to recover compensation if you've suffered from a pneumothorax or a punctured lung. In certain situations you could be eligible to receive compensation for suffering and pain and out of pocket expenses.

A pneumothorax is characterized as abrupt breathing problems and chest pain. The condition could be fatal, and if it isn't treated, it can lead to death.

The condition can be caused by an accident, medical mistake, or an injury to the chest. It could be caused by an lung diseases that are underlying.

Pneumothorax typically occurs following an incident that is traumatizing. The most frequent causes are chest injuries that are blunt such as from a car crash or assault. The chest injury can be caused by acupuncture, surgery or dry needling.

A chest X-ray and physical examination can help to diagnose punctured lungs. They can also be identified with ultrasound or computed-tomography (CT).

Treatment options will vary according to the size and severity of the punctured lung. For smaller cases the lung can heal on its own. Larger cases may require chest tubes or the use of syringes.

A pneumothorax can be extremely painful and take several weeks to heal. A pneumothorax typically is not life-threatening. If you have any of these symptoms such as breathing problems, pain in your chest, dizziness, nausea, or any other signs need urgent medical attention immediately.

People suffering from pneumothorax may suffer from a decrease in oxygen levels in their blood. This can cause a bluish tone to their skin. The addition of oxygen can aid in breathing easier.

A rib fracture could be one of the most severe injuries you can sustain. It can cause extreme pain and damage to the blood vessels and internal organs.

Although there is no magic bullet to fix a broken rib, there are several ways to alleviate pain and speed up healing. This includes resting, applying an ice pack, and taking pain medication.

Another important step is to see a doctor. Most people recover from a rib fracture within some weeks. However, severe cases may require surgery.

Additionally, you must be aware of how to take care of your ribs to avoid complications. Wrapping your torso in a tight manner can hinder the ability to breathe. This can lead to a punctured lung or even collapsed lung. Fortunately, the right steps can help prevent these problems.

Depending on the condition you may have to use an ice pack in order to reduce swelling. It is also possible to avoid activities which could cause further damage.
